    I know it's a bit late but the T&C's say

    The prize does NOT include :
    • Any additional travel costs (including getting to/from London Heathrow Airport)
    • Airline / Departure Tax (Texas) – approx. £250/£300 per person payable to the Airline prior to departure
    • Meals or drinks other than breakfast (unless otherwise specified)
    • Spending money
    So a winner will have a bill of £500-£600 to accept the prize.
